Is there a 'physics of society'? Ranging from Hobbes & Adam Smith to modern work on traffic flow & market trading, & across economics, sociology & psychology, Philip Ball shows how much we can understand of human behaviour when we cease to try to predict & analyse the behaviour of individuals & look to the impact of hundreds, thousands or millions of individual human decisions, whether in circumstances in which human beings co-operate or conflict, when their aggregate behaviour is constructive & when it is destructive. By perhaps Britain's leading young science writer, this is a deeply thought-provoking book, causing us to examine our own behaviour, whether in buying the new Harry Potter book, voting for a particular party or responding to the lures of advertisers. ...

Denis Stone, a naive young poet, is invited to stay at Crome, a country house renowned for its gatherings of 'bright young things'. Crome's hosts, the world-weary Henry Wimbush & his exotic wife Priscilla are joined by a party of colourful guests whose intrigues & opinions ensure Denis's stay is a memorable one. In the course of the weekend Henry tells his guests fantastical stories from the history of the house, Mr Barbecue-Smith invents inspirational aphorisms conceived in trances, Mary dispense with her virginity on the roof, the local vicar prophesies the Apocalypse, the annual Crome Fair takes place & Denis tries to capture it all in poetry & has his heart broken. First published in 1921, Crome Yellow was Aldous Huxley's much-acclaimed debut novel. With the evident relish of the true satirist, he mocked the fads, foibles & spirit of his time with an unsurpassed wit & brilliance. ...

A boy has been crucified in Galway city.

People are shocked; the broadsheets debate how the brutal death reflects the state of the nation; the Irish Church is scandalized. No further action is taken.

Then the sister of the murdered boy is burned alive & PI Jack Taylor decides to take matters into his own hands.
